Cup Diameter
The Bruno Tilz 310-M 42 has a cup diameter of 33.00 mm / 1.2992 in compared to 31.25 mm / 1.2303 in on the Denis Wick 3SL — a difference of 1.75 mm / 0.0689 in. A wider cup generally produces a fuller, darker tone but requires more air support.
Throat Diameter
The Bruno Tilz 310-M 42 has a wider throat (8.90 mm / 0.3504 in vs 7.62 mm / 0.3000 in). A wider throat allows more air through, increasing volume and projection but reducing resistance.
